Key Features

✓Full song generation with vocals and instrumentals
✓Custom lyrics input and AI lyric generation
✓Multi-genre support (pop, rock, jazz, electronic, classical)
✓Advanced vocal synthesis with emotional expression
✓Stem separation for individual track control
✓Song extension and continuation

        Pros & Cons

        ✅Pros

        • •Can generate surprisingly polished full-song drafts quickly
        • •Easy for non-musicians to use without production skills
        • •Extension and remix features improve iteration speed
        • •Good fit for creator content and fast audio prototyping

        ❌Cons

        • •Official pricing details and plan limits are not very readable in plain public text
        • •Fine control is limited compared with traditional music production tools
        • •Output consistency can vary from generation to generation
        • •Commercial use and originality questions need careful review
